On Fri, Jan 19, 2018 at 10:36:29AM +0000, Francesco Del Degan wrote:
> On Fri, 19 Jan 2018 09:58:38 +0100, Greg KH wrote:
> 
> > Really?  What are you going to do when this goes end-of-life in 3
> > months?  Seems like you should already be planning for that, right?
> 
> In EOL, we will be just like others that want to provide extended 
> (custom) support, we are on our own. But that's is another problem, I 
> guess.

It's a worse problem.  Unless you duplicate the effort that the stable
maintainers do, your machines are going to be insecure.  Remember, it
takes _more_ work to maintain a kernel longer, than it did previously.
So soon you are going to be doing more work than I am, have fun!  :)

And again, why can you just not update to a newer kernel version?  Do
you have a huge out-of-tree patchset you rely on?  If so, best of luck,
you should be billing whom ever forces you to use that code as it is not
going to be easy.
